80万字| 连载| 2026-05-29 02:49:43 更新
在享受国外影视剧、纪录片或学习视频时,中文字幕无疑是跨越语言障碍的桥梁。然而,不少用户都曾遭遇过令人头疼的“中文字幕乱码”问题——屏幕上显示的并非清晰的汉字,而是一堆无法识别的“天书”字符,如“锟斤拷烫烫烫”或各种方框问号,严重影响了观看与学习。本文将深入探讨中文字幕乱码的成因,并提供一套系统且实用的中文字幕乱码的解决方法,帮助您彻底告别这一烦恼,畅享无障碍的视听世界。 理解乱码根源:编码格式的“语言不通” 要解决问题,首先要了解其根源。中文字幕乱码的核心原因在于“编码格式不匹配”。简单来说,计算机存储和显示文字需要一套规则,这就是编码。常见的文本编码格式有UTF-8、GBK、GB2312、ANSI、Big5等。 中文字幕文件(通常是.srt、.ass、.ssa等格式)在制作或保存时,使用的是某种特定的编码。当您的播放器或设备在读取这个文件时,如果使用了另一种不同的编码规则去解码,就会导致信息解读错误,从而产生乱码。例如,一个原本用GBK编码保存的简体中文字幕,被播放器误用UTF-8编码打开,就会出现乱码。此外,文件本身损坏、字幕字体缺失或播放器设置不当,也可能引发或加剧乱码现象。 核心解决策略:从播放器设置到文件转码 面对中文字幕乱码,我们可以按照从易到难的顺序,尝试以下一系列中文字幕乱码的解决方法。 第一,优先调整播放器内建设置。这是最快捷的途径。绝大多数现代播放器(如VLC Media Player、PotPlayer、MPC-HC等)都提供了强大的字幕编码切换功能。以VLC为例,在播放视频时,依次点击菜单栏的“字幕” -> “字幕轨道” -> “选择字幕编码”,在弹出的列表中尝试切换不同的编码格式,如“简体中文(GBK/GB2312)”、“通用字符集(UTF-8)”或“繁体中文(Big5)”。通常,切换一两次后,乱码问题就能迎刃而解。PotPlayer用户则可以在字幕渲染器设置中直接选择“字符集/代码页”进行切换。 第二,巧用文本编辑器转换编码。如果播放器内建功能无法解决,我们可以直接修改字幕文件本身。使用系统自带的记事本(Notepad)并非最佳选择,因为它对编码的支持有限且容易出错。推荐使用专业的文本编辑器,如Notepad++、Sublime Text或Visual Studio Code。 操作步骤如下:首先,用Notepad++打开乱码的字幕文件。此时,文件可能显示为乱码。接着,查看软件顶部菜单栏的“编码”选项,它会显示当前猜测的编码(如“以UTF-8无BOM格式编码”)。此时,您需要手动选择正确的原始编码来重新加载文件。尝试点击“编码” -> “字符集” -> “中文”,然后分别选择“GB2312”或“GBK”。如果字幕显示正常了,说明找到了正确编码。最后,再次点击“编码” -> “转换为UTF-8编码”(推荐,因为UTF-8兼容性最广),然后保存文件。之后用播放器加载这个新保存的UTF-8字幕文件,乱码问题基本就能解决。 第三,借助专业字幕工具。对于批量化处理或更复杂的字幕问题(如内嵌字幕的影片),可以使用专门的字幕工具,如Subtitle Edit、Aegisub等。这些工具不仅能轻松转换编码,还能修复时间轴、调整样式,功能非常全面。 第四,检查字体与文件完整性。有时候乱码可能是由于系统缺少字幕文件指定的特殊字体导致,尤其是在.ass/.ssa等高级字幕中。可以尝试在播放器设置中将字幕字体更改为系统内已安装的常见中文字体(如微软雅黑、宋体)。此外,确保字幕文件没有损坏,可以尝试重新下载一份字幕。 预防胜于治疗:日常使用好习惯 除了事后的解决方法,养成良好习惯能有效避免中文字幕乱码的发生。 首先,优先下载UTF-8编码的字幕。如今,许多大型字幕站(如字幕库、SubHD)都会提供UTF-8编码的字幕选项,其通用性最强,在绝大多数设备和播放器上都能正确显示。 其次,保持播放器更新。新版播放器通常对各类编码的支持更完善,解码能力更强。 最后,统一命名与存放。将视频文件与对应的字幕文件放在同一文件夹下,并确保主文件名完全相同(如“Movie.2023.mp4”和“Movie.2023.srt”),这样播放器通常会自动加载,减少手动加载可能带来的编码识别错误。 总而言之,中文字幕乱码虽然烦人,但并非无法攻克的技术难题。通过理解编码原理,并灵活运用播放器设置调整、文本编辑器转码等中文字幕乱码的解决方法,您完全可以轻松应对。希望本文的指南能助您扫清障碍,尽情沉浸在精彩纷呈的影视与知识海洋之中。
在享受国外影视剧、纪录片或学习视频时,中文字幕无疑是跨越语言障碍的桥梁。然而,不少用户都曾遭遇过令人头疼的“中文字幕乱码”问题——屏幕上显示的并非清晰的汉字,而是一堆无法识别的“天书”字符,如“锟斤拷烫烫烫”或各种方框问号,严重影响了观看与学习。本文将深入探讨中文字幕乱码的成因,并提供一套系统且实用的中文字幕乱码的解决方法,帮助您彻底告别这一烦恼,畅享无障碍的视听世界。 理解乱码根源:编码格式的“语言不通” 要解决问题,首先要了解其根源。中文字幕乱码的核心原因在于“编码格式不匹配”。简单来说,计算机存储和显示文字需要一套规则,这就是编码。常见的文本编码格式有UTF-8、GBK、GB2312、ANSI、Big5等。 中文字幕文件(通常是.srt、.ass、.ssa等格式)在制作或保存时,使用的是某种特定的编码。当您的播放器或设备在读取这个文件时,如果使用了另一种不同的编码规则去解码,就会导致信息解读错误,从而产生乱码。例如,一个原本用GBK编码保存的简体中文字幕,被播放器误用UTF-8编码打开,就会出现乱码。此外,文件本身损坏、字幕字体缺失或播放器设置不当,也可能引发或加剧乱码现象。 核心解决策略:从播放器设置到文件转码 面对中文字幕乱码,我们可以按照从易到难的顺序,尝试以下一系列中文字幕乱码的解决方法。 第一,优先调整播放器内建设置。这是最快捷的途径。绝大多数现代播放器(如VLC Media Player、PotPlayer、MPC-HC等)都提供了强大的字幕编码切换功能。以VLC为例,在播放视频时,依次点击菜单栏的“字幕” -> “字幕轨道” -> “选择字幕编码”,在弹出的列表中尝试切换不同的编码格式,如“简体中文(GBK/GB2312)”、“通用字符集(UTF-8)”或“繁体中文(Big5)”。通常,切换一两次后,乱码问题就能迎刃而解。PotPlayer用户则可以在字幕渲染器设置中直接选择“字符集/代码页”进行切换。 第二,巧用文本编辑器转换编码。如果播放器内建功能无法解决,我们可以直接修改字幕文件本身。使用系统自带的记事本(Notepad)并非最佳选择,因为它对编码的支持有限且容易出错。推荐使用专业的文本编辑器,如Notepad++、Sublime Text或Visual Studio Code。 操作步骤如下:首先,用Notepad++打开乱码的字幕文件。此时,文件可能显示为乱码。接着,查看软件顶部菜单栏的“编码”选项,它会显示当前猜测的编码(如“以UTF-8无BOM格式编码”)。此时,您需要手动选择正确的原始编码来重新加载文件。尝试点击“编码” -> “字符集” -> “中文”,然后分别选择“GB2312”或“GBK”。如果字幕显示正常了,说明找到了正确编码。最后,再次点击“编码” -> “转换为UTF-8编码”(推荐,因为UTF-8兼容性最广),然后保存文件。之后用播放器加载这个新保存的UTF-8字幕文件,乱码问题基本就能解决。 第三,借助专业字幕工具。对于批量化处理或更复杂的字幕问题(如内嵌字幕的影片),可以使用专门的字幕工具,如Subtitle Edit、Aegisub等。这些工具不仅能轻松转换编码,还能修复时间轴、调整样式,功能非常全面。 第四,检查字体与文件完整性。有时候乱码可能是由于系统缺少字幕文件指定的特殊字体导致,尤其是在.ass/.ssa等高级字幕中。可以尝试在播放器设置中将字幕字体更改为系统内已安装的常见中文字体(如微软雅黑、宋体)。此外,确保字幕文件没有损坏,可以尝试重新下载一份字幕。 预防胜于治疗:日常使用好习惯 除了事后的解决方法,养成良好习惯能有效避免中文字幕乱码的发生。 首先,优先下载UTF-8编码的字幕。如今,许多大型字幕站(如字幕库、SubHD)都会提供UTF-8编码的字幕选项,其通用性最强,在绝大多数设备和播放器上都能正确显示。 其次,保持播放器更新。新版播放器通常对各类编码的支持更完善,解码能力更强。 最后,统一命名与存放。将视频文件与对应的字幕文件放在同一文件夹下,并确保主文件名完全相同(如“Movie.2023.mp4”和“Movie.2023.srt”),这样播放器通常会自动加载,减少手动加载可能带来的编码识别错误。 总而言之,中文字幕乱码虽然烦人,但并非无法攻克的技术难题。通过理解编码原理,并灵活运用播放器设置调整、文本编辑器转码等中文字幕乱码的解决方法,您完全可以轻松应对。希望本文的指南能助您扫清障碍,尽情沉浸在精彩纷呈的影视与知识海洋之中。